Changing into the Likeness of Christ In Session Five: I Have the Promise of Eternal Life, the setting remains unchanged but the story is refocused from a unique perspective. An indignant thief, sentenced to humiliation and death, watches from atop his crucified perch as Jesus is brought to Golgotha. It is through his eyes that the beginning of true hope is introduced into the crucifixion story. Before watching the video turn in your Bibles and read his story in Luke 23:32-43. • What do you notice in this section of Scripture? Watch Easter Experience: Session Five – I Have the Promise of Eternal Life (26:51) • Did you ever notice that both thieves (Matthew 27:44) originally mocked and jeered at Jesus? Why do people often mock what they don’t understand? • The Bible does not explain what happened in the heart of the thief on the cross, but which of the three options do you think is most likely the agent of change in the thief’s last hours? Why? o Seeing how Jesus endured the physical pain of scourging and crucifixion? o Seeing how Jesus interacted with his mother and the disciples? o Seeing how Jesus was willing to forgive those who were crucifying him? • Who do you most identify with at the scene of the crucifixion? • The thief on the cross was not included in the Bible to demonstrate that everyone deserves God’s grace, but rather to demonstrate that even those who do not deserve grace (those who have sinned) can still receive it.
